Derazan (

Romanized as Derāzān,[3] is a village in Dasht-e Sar-e Sofla Rural District of the Central District of Amol County, Mazandaran province, Iran
.

At the 2006 National Census, its population was 1,211 in 338 households, when it was in Bala Khiyaban-e Litkuh Rural District.[4] The following census in 2011 counted 1,423 people in 434 households,[5] by which time Dasht-e Sar-e Sofla Rural District had been established.[6] The latest census in 2016 showed a population of 1,472 people in 501 households. It was the most populous village in its rural district.[2]
